As a family we have eaten out on Christmas Day for many years and have varied levels of success. Being frequent customers here we managed to make a booking for our family Christmas lunch and we’re delighted.This is a proper, traditional pub where you are welcomed by the landlord and a warm fire. I avoid the modern ‘plastic’ Christmas vibe of piped Muzak, strict timings for sittings and mass catering. The Black Horse was a breath of fresh air. We were unhurried but thoughtfully attended to without having to get out to allow for the next sitting.Our meals were all faultless and fresh. We had between the Traditional turkey, a risotto which was generous with the lobster and I had the vegetarian roast. The starters of Gravelax and Soufflé were all fresh and delicious.Considering the whole dining and bar areas were full we were delighted with the whole experience and highly we recommended it to friends.

My family of five went to celebrate two birthdays at this restaurant. The staff were friendly and helpful, but despite the pub not being very busy, our food took about an hour to arrive. Two out of the five of us enjoyed our meals, but the lasagna was dry and overcooked, and the beef burgers for two of us were undercooked and came without any dressing or condiments. The coleslaw that was advertised was barely a teaspoonful, which I ate in one bite. The chips were tasty, but overall, the experience was disappointing considering the price.
